Abstract: Pyrido-benzothiazine derivatives having the following general formula: ##STR1## in which R is H or a C.sub.1 -C.sub.6 alkyl or a C.sub.1 -C.sub.6 fluoroalkyl, and R.sub.1 is N-alkyl-3-pyrrolidinalkylamine with C.sub.1 to C.sub.6 alkyls or ##STR2## where R.sub.2 is a S.sub.1 -C.sub.6 alkyl or a C.sub.2 -C.sub.6 alkenyl or an arylalkyl group, possibly substituted by halogen, hydroxy or keto-groups, both in the racemic form and in the optically active form.The invention also comprises the process for the preparation of derivatives of formula (I) starting from 2.4-difluoro-3-chloronitrobenzene.Said derivatives possess a high antibacterial acitvity as well as a high bioavailability to tissues; the invention also refers to pharmaceutical compositions containing them as active components.

Abstract: Pyrido-benzothiazine compounds having anti-microbial activity are prepared by (a) reacting 3-chloro-4-fluoroaniline with potassium thiocyanate and bromine to produce 2-amino-6-fluoro-7-chlorobenzothiazole, (b) reacting 2-amino-6-fluoro-7-chlorobenzothiazole with sodium hydroxide to produce the disulfide of 2-amino-5-fluoro 6-chlorothiophenol, (c) reacting the disulfide with sodium monochloroacetate to produce 7-fluoro-8-chloro-2H-1,4-benzothiazin-3(4H)-one, (d) reducing 7-fluoro-8-chloro-2H-1,4-benzothiazin-3(4H)-one to produce 7-fluoro-8-chloro-3,4-dihydro-2H-1,4-benzothiazone, (e) reacting 7-fluoro-8-chloro-3,4-dihydro-2-H-1,4-benzothiazone with ethyl ethoxymethylenemalonate and cyclyzing the intermediate formed with polyphosphoric acid to produce ethyl 9-fluoro-10-chloro-7-oxo-2,3-dihydro-7H-pyrido[1,2,3 de] [1,4]-benzothiazine-6-carboxylate and (f) hydrolyizing the ethyl carboxylate to produce the corresponding carboxylic acid.

Abstract: Object of the invention is a class of new organic compounds derived from 1,4-benzothiazine through substitution of an hydrogen atom in position 6, 7 or 8 by an oxypropanolammine radical monosubstituted in N and furthermore a series of new phenyl derivatives of 1,4-benzothiazine, obtained as intermediate in the synthesis of oxypropanolammine derivatives, and process for obtained the new compounds in form suitable for the preparation of pharmaceutical compositions having antihypertensive, vasodilating and antiarrhythmic activity.

Abstract: 1,2 Benzothiazino[3,4-d]pyrazoles of the following general formula ##STR1## wherein R stands for a linear or branched (C.sub.2-4) alkyl chain bearing a substituent of formula ##STR2## in which the R" radicals may be the same or different and represent hydrogen, (C.sub.2-4)alkyl, (C.sub.4-7) cycloalkyl or, taken together with the adjacent nitrogen atom, may also represent a saturated, 5 to 7 membered heterocyclic ring containing from one to three heteroatoms independently selected from O,N and S, or R may represent the 1-ethyl-pyrrolidine-2-yl-methyl radical, and R' is hydrogen, a halogen atom or a (C.sub.1-4) alkyl radical; methods for their preparation; pharmaceutical compositions containing them. The compounds possess antiinflammatory, antipyretic and analgesic activity.
Abstract: The invention provides 2-(2-thenoylthio)-propionylglycine, a novel compound having liver-protective, mucolytic and bronchial-spasm relieving activity.
